Context
Gary and Dustin are a modern-day couple engaged in an alternative type of therapy: Antebellum Sexual Performance Therapy. The unusual style of therapy is designed to help black partners regain sexual pleasure with their white partners by understanding how their own racial identities and history play into their sexual relationship.
